CREDIT NUMBER 2645 IN Development Credit Agreement (Industrial Pollution Prevention Project) between India and INTERNATIONAL DEVELOPMENT ASSOCIATION Dated , 1994 CREDIT NUMBER 2645 IN DEVELOPMENT CREDIT AGREEMENT AGREEMENT, dated / 4~,i-/ , 1994, between INDIA (the Borrower), acting by its President, and INTERNATIONAL DEVELOPMENT ASSOCIATION (the Association). WHEREAS (A) the Borrower, having satisfied itself as to the feasibility and priority of the Project described in Schedule 2 to this Agreement, has requested the Association to assist in the financing of the Project; (B) the Industrial Credit and Investment Corporation of India (ICICI) has also requested the International Bank for Reconstruction and Development (the Bank) to provide assistance towards the financing of Part B(1) of the Project and by an agreement of even date herewith between the Bank and ICICI (the ICICI Loan Agreement), the Bank is agreeing to provide such assistance in an aggregate principal amount equivalent to fifty million dollars ($50,000,000) (the ICICI Loan); (C) by an agreement of even date herewith between the Borrower and the Bank (the ICICI Guarantee Agreement), the Borrower is agreeing to guarantee the obligations of ICICI in respect of the ICICI Loan and to undertake such other obligations as are set forth in the ICICI Guarantee Agreement; (D) the Industrial Development Bank of India (IDBI) has also requested the Bank to provide assistance towards the financing of Parts B(1), B(2) and C(3) of the Project and by an agreement of even date herewith between the Bank and IDBI (the IDBI Loan Agreement), the Bank is agreeing to provide such assistance in an aggregate principal amount equivalent to ninety-three million dollars ($93,000,000) (the IDBI Loan); (E) by an agreement of even date herewith between the Borrower and the Bank (the IDBI Guarantee Agreement), the Borrower is agreeing to guarantee the obligations of IDBI in respect of the IDBI Loan and to undertake such other obligations as set forth in the IDBI Guarantee Agreement; and (F) Parts A, C(1), C(2) and C(4) of the Project will be carried out by the Borrower, Part B(1) of the Project will be carried out by ICICI and IDBI and Parts B(2) and C(3) of the Project will be carried out by IDBI with the assistance of the Borrower; and -2- WHEREAS the Association has agreed, on the basis, inter alia, of the foregoing, to extend the Credit to the Borrower upon the terms and conditions set forth or referred to in this Agreement, the ICICI Loan Agreement, the ICIGL Guarantee Agreement, the IDBI Loan Agreement and the IDBI Guarantee Agreement respectively; NOW THEREFORE the parties hereto hereby agree as follows: ARTICLE I General Conditions; Definitions Section 1.01. The Association agrees to lend to the Borrower, on the terms and conditions set forth or referred to in the Development Credit Agreement, an amount in various currencies equivalent to seventeen million seven hundred thousand Special Drawing Rights (SDR 17,700,000). The Borrower shall pay to the Association a service charge at the rate of three-fourths of one percent (3/4 of 1%) per annum on the principal amount of the Credit withdrawn and outstanding from time to time. Section 2.06. Commitment charges and service charges shall be payable semiannually on June 15 and December 15 in each year. Section 2.07. (a) Subject to paragraphs (b) and (c) below, the Borrower shall repay the principal amount of the Credit in semi- annual installments payable on each June 15 and December 15 commencing December 15, 2004 and ending June 15, 2029. Each installment to and including the installment payable on June 15, 2014 shall be one and one-fourth percent (1-1/4%) of such principal amount, and each installment thereafter shall be two and one-half percent (2-1/2%) of such principal amount. (b) Whenever (i) the Borrower's gross national product per capita, as determined by the Association, shall have exceeded $790 in constant 1985 dollars for five consecutive years, and (ii) the Bank shall consider the Borrower creditworthy for Bank lending, the Association may, subsequent to the review and approval thereof by the Executive Directors of the Association and after due consideration by them of the development of the Borrower's economy, modify the terms of repayment of installments under paragraph (a) above by requiring the Borrower to repay twice the amount of each such installment not yet due until the principal amount of the Credit shall have been repaid. If so requested by the Borrower, the Association may revise such modification to include, in lieu of some or all of the increase in the amounts of such installments, the payment of interest at an annual rate agreed with the Association on the principal amount of the Credit withdrawn and outstanding from -6- time to time, provided that, in the judgment of the Association, such revision shall not change the grant element obtained under the above-mentioned repayment modification. (c) If, at any time after a modification of terms pursuant to paragraph (b) above, the Association determines that the Borrower's economic condition has deteriorated significantly, the Association may, if so requested by the Borrower, further modify the terms of repayment to conform to the schedule of installments as provided in paragraph (a) above. The Association may require withdrawals from the Credit Account to be made on the basis of statements of expenditure for expenditures for (a) goods and works under contracts not exceeding $500,000 equivalent; and (b) services and training under contracts not exceeding $100,000 equivalent for employment of consulting firms and $50,000 equivalent for employment of individual consultants respectively, all under such terms and conditions as the Association shall specify by notice to the Borrower. - 14 - SCHEDULE 2 Description of the Project The main objective of the Project is to promote cost-effective pollution abatement and, in particular, to strengthen the institu- tional capacity of the Borrower and the SPCBs in four States; facilitate priority investments in clean technologies, waste minimization and resource recovery as well as pollution control; and promote the development, diffusion and transfer of technologies with environmental benefits for the industrial sector of the Borrower. The Project consists of the following parts, subject to such modifications thereof as the Borrower and the Association may agree upon from time to time to achieve such objectives: Part A: Institutional Development Strengthening of SPCBs in the Project States in order to enhance their technical, institutional, monitoring and enforcement capabilities through: (1) Training: Training of SPCB staff in technical and managerial skills in the following areas: (a) quality assurance and quality control of laboratory activities; (b) maintenance and operation training; (c) specialized technical training; and (d) supervisory training for management of the work of laboratories and for planning and implementing pollution control strategies. (2) Eguipment: Improvement in analytical and monitoring equipment for central laboratories in each Project State as well as for smaller regional laboratories. (3) Laboratory Facilities: Refurbishing laboratory facilities including upgrading existing facilities, and the provision of additional space and infrastructure. (4) Geographical Information System: Establishment of a pilot phase of a Geographical Information System at the Gujarat State Pollution Control Board to assist in the monitoring and tracking of toxic residue. - 15 - Part B: Investments Provision of credit to individual firms for pollution abatement with focus on waste minimization and adoption of cleaner methods of production consisting of the following: (1) Individual Treatment Facilities: Undertaking of Investment Projects relating to the designing and implementation of waste minimization, resource recovery and pollution abatement schemes by individual enterprises in targeted sectors. (2) Common Treatment Facilities: (a) Undertaking of Investment Projects for establishing common effluent treatment facilities for the treatment of wastewater, solid waste and gaseous emissions generated by small scale industries at industrial estates and other sites; (b) establishment or strengthening of municipal wastewater recycling facilities providing water to industries, owned, operated and maintained on a commercial basis by companies fully responsible and liable for the operation of such units; and (c) carrying out of such studies as may be required for the location, design, and implementation of common treatment facilities. Part C: Technical Assistance (1) Establishment of a "clean technology institutional network" designed to promote the development, diffusion and transfer of technologies with environmental benefits for the industrial sector. (2) Identification of appropriate waste minimization and abatement methods for small scale industry, and the organization of waste minimization circles. (3) Carrying out feasibility and pre-investment studies for CETPs, IWRPs and other facilities to be financed under Part B of the Project. (4) Provision of training and consultants' services to assist the Borrower's Ministry of Environment and Forests. The Project-is expected to be completed by September 30, 2001. - 16 - SCHEDULE 3 Procurement and Consultants' Services Section I. The Borrower shall ensure that the SPCBs have adequate office and laboratory facilities to properly operate and maintain equipment supplied to them under the Project. 2. The Borrower shall maintain the Steering Committee and the Implementation Cell in its Ministry of Environment and Forests, with adequate staff, resources and facilities and provide requisite assistance to them to carry out their functions properly. 3. The Borrower shall, by December 31, 1994, set up a task force, acceptable to the Association, to carry out further analysis of market-based instruments for pollution abatement, under terms of reference satisfactory to the Association; and shall, thereafter, discuss with the Association steps for the implementation of such program. 4. The Borrower shall, by December 31, 1994, establish general indicators, satisfactory to the Association, to measure implementation of the Project, including compliance of the industrial sector with applicable regulations as well as emission of key pollutants. 5. The Borrower shall, by June 30, 1995, prepare an action plan, satisfactory to the Association, for institutional strengthening of the SPCB of each Project State. - 21 - SCHEDULE 5 Special Account 1.
